Biography

Lewis Strong is an Anzac who served in World War Two.

Lewis Alfred Strong was born in 1923, the elder son of Mabel Ellen (neé Taft) and William Strong of 2 Opua Street, Belmont, Auckland, New Zealand.

He was a keen yachtsman, educated at Belmont School and the Seddon Memorial Technical College. [1]

Private Lewis Alfred Strong NZ443879 New Zealand Infantry, 25 Battalion

Killed in action in Italy 3rd February 1945; he was 22 years old

burial - Faenza War Cemetery, Emilia Romagna, Italy - grave : I. B. 1. [2]
